Tech firm DataCom Malawi Limited, has supported the ICT Association of Malawi (ICTAM) with 10 million kwacha for the 2026 annual ICT Expo.
Speaking during the cheque presentation ceremony in Lilongwe, DataCom Managing Director, Moses Nthakomwa, emphasised the company’s commitment to supporting Malawi’s digital transformation agenda.
Nthakomwa observed that the digital future of Malawi depends on collaboration between various players within the ICT sector hence the support towards the ICT platform created by ICTAM. He further indicated that supporting the expo aligns with the institution’s vision of promoting innovation, digital inclusion and the adoption of modern technologies.
Meanwhile, ICTAM representative Jacqueline Kamdima applauded the company for the support as they continue to raise funds for the success of the Expo which will be held under the theme ‘Unlocking Malawi’s Digital Economy: lCT Exports, Trusted Payments and Fraud Resilience.’
Kamdima noted that ICTAM seeks to raise 200 million kwacha for the three-day event, however, they have managed to source 120 million.
Scheduled for June 3 to 5, the Expo is expected to bring together ICT professionals, policymakers, innovators and businesses to discuss digital fraud and other emerging tech challenges.
